Dysrhythmia Exam is requiredOncology experience preferred, not requiredBLS, NIH Required12 HR NightsUnit Specific Details:32 Bed UnitCVC line draws, IV starts, med passHoyer lift , Arjo equipment, Alaris pump, Epidural/PCA pumps, CVC line draws, Kangaroo pumps, Wound vacs, high flow o2Job Profile Name RN Med Surg Job Code 740N31 Include Job Code in Name Yes Job Profile SummaryJob Description Summary of Primary Function/General Purpose of Position The Registered Nurse Medical/Surgical functionsas a care provider of a multidisciplinary care team responsible for the delivery of patient care through using thenursing process of assessment, diagnosing, planning, implementation, and evaluation. The RN possesses the basicknowledge of a patient’s age and cultural diversity into the provision of patient care, demonstrates strong skillsrelated to effective time management and prioritizing patient care, contributes to the provision of quality nursingcare through performance improvement initiatives, collaborates with other professional disciplines, and supports themission of the ministry to provide physical and psychological support to patients and families. Essential Job FunctionsIn collaboration with members of interdisciplinary teams, the RN establishes goals and strategies for meeting thedischarge or continuing care needs with the patient. The RN performs and documents complete patient assessments,initiates and maintains current nursing care plans for all assigned patients, identifies patient learning needs toprovide individualized and comprehensive teaching, administers medications in a safe manner consistent with the Stateof Practice and Bon Secours Mercy Health policies and procedures, serves as a point of contact for patient’s carecoordination throughout the hospital departments, acts as a patient safety advocate by participating in ongoing qualityimprovement in the department, and serves as a patient advocate in collaboration with spiritual care, palliative care,and ethics.
